7. Two suggestions
One, a jumprope, if your ceilings are high enough. A mat could be used under it. Very cheap!

Two, a topic which I have mentioned on DU a few times but no one has taken me up on. Russian kettlebells - it's in many ways doing aerobics with 16-88 lb weights. There's a lot of carryover to other activities, and the workout can vary in intensity from 'light sweat' to 'puke on the floor', depending on your mood. Have you ever swum freestyle in a pool as fast as you could, or done high school wrestling matches? Those are the only two activities I can think of that have a similar level of effort. Once you've mastered the technique (and there are books & videos available), you can safely do this indoors. A single kettlebell is all you need to get started.
